The 2015-16 NBA season is officially underway as all eyes are on Kobe Bryant and the team’s young core. While the Los Angeles Lakers suffered a tough season opener loss to the Minnesota Timberwolves, they will travel to face DeMarcus Cousins and the Sacramento Kings tonight.

One of the most anticipated games this season will come on Christmas Day as the Lakers host the Clippers. While the game is nearly two months away, numerous teams unveiled their Christmas Day uniforms today via the official Twitter account:

Over the last couple of seasons, fans have been critical of the Christmas Day jerseys. Unlike years past that ranged from first names on the back to sleeves, this year’s jersey is very clean with the purple lettering to go along with the white uniform.
